Aston Villa's Europa League Triumph: A Springboard to Higher Ambitions?

Aston Villa secured a commanding victory in the Europa League final, showcasing Unai Emery's tactical prowess. The win is seen as a significant step, but the club now aims for even greater achievements.

  • Aston Villa won the Europa League final with a dominant performance.
  • Unai Emery reaffirmed his reputation as a master of European competitions.
  • The victory is viewed as a foundation for Aston Villa to build towards higher domestic and European targets.
  • The club's ownership and management are expected to support further development.
  • The focus now shifts to sustained success in the Premier League and Champions League qualification.

Aston Villa delivered a performance of undeniable superiority in the recent Europa League final, securing a victory that felt less like a tense contest and more like a celebratory procession. The manner of their triumph has not only brought silverware back to Villa Park but has also firmly re-established Unai Emery's credentials as a manager with a remarkable affinity for European knockout competitions. The win, described by some as a display of flexing their dominance, left fans relishing every moment rather than anxiously awaiting the final whistle.

While the immediate joy of lifting the trophy is palpable, the sentiment within the club and among commentators is that this success must serve as a crucial stepping stone. Jonathan Wilson, reflecting on the victory, suggested that while Emery has reconfirmed his status, his sights will now undoubtedly be set higher. The challenge for Aston Villa is to translate this continental success into sustained domestic excellence and ultimately, regular participation in the Champions League.

Emery's arrival at Villa Park heralded a significant upturn in the club's fortunes. His tactical acumen and ability to organise a cohesive unit have been key to their progress. This Europa League triumph is a tangible reward for the strategic decisions made since his appointment and a testament to the hard work of the squad. The squad's depth and resilience were evident throughout the tournament, culminating in a final where they controlled proceedings from the outset.

The club's ownership will now be under pressure to capitalise on this momentum. Investment in the playing squad, coupled with continued development of infrastructure, will be vital to ensure that this European success is not an isolated event but rather the start of a new era. The aspiration will be to challenge the Premier League's established 'big six' more consistently and to become a regular fixture in Europe's elite club competition.

For the fans, the victory evokes echoes of past glories, reminding them of a rich history in European football. However, the current focus is firmly on the future. The question now is not just about celebrating a significant achievement, but about how Aston Villa will leverage this triumph to elevate their standing in both English and European football, aiming for the ultimate prize of Champions League football and sustained domestic contention.
